Output 16f41c9787714604e4de289ae3255a9e593043ef0665539938ad3ff183939097:0

value
20147338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de27b9d18a02da967ccb70fe1922ae51d2e4b331 OP_EQUAL
address
3MwfXL957grYnoeL8WqvKSvpzKY7VGMmBj
transaction
16f41c9787714604e4de289ae3255a9e593043ef0665539938ad3ff183939097
spent
true